RUSU volunteers all take part in the RMIT LEAD accredited volunteer program, this means once you have completed 5 hours of training and 15 hours volunteering over the year, you'll receive recognition on your academic transcript, with a certificate also signed by the vice chancellor, crediting your time volunteering at RMIT. Student Rights & Appeals Volunteer:
RUSU trains and coordinates student representatives to sit on appeals panels for College Appeals, University Appeals Committee Hearings and Discipline Board. Basically this means that if a student is appealing a grade, accused of plagiarism or appealing a special consideration decision, their case is heard by a panel. This panel includes one student representative.
